France faces grid bottlenecks, with 10% of territory already saturated Around 10% of the country now faces grid constraints, prompting power distributor Enedis to plan 100 new substations by 2030 to support further renewable energy deployment.

France’s Reden halts solar module production Reden has halted solar module production at its Roquefort-sur-Soulzon facility, citing mounting cost pressures and competition from Asian manufacturers. The closure marks another setback for French solar manufacturing, leaving Voltec as the country’s only remaining PV panel producer.

Shallow gabion foundations enable solar plant deployment on archaeological site Shallow gabion foundations enabled the installation of a solar plant on an archaeological site with minimal ground disturbance. The approach ensures structural stability while preserving sensitive subsurface heritage through a fully reversible foundation system.

French startup offers concrete solar carport for heavy weight vehicles Visionpark is developing a concrete-structure photovoltaic canopy for heavy-duty vehicle parking areas, logistics hubs, and highway rest stops. In addition to generating electricity, the installation is designed to maintain refrigerated trucks at the required temperature and provide power while vehicles are stationary.

Lidl launches 2.24 kWh battery in Germany for €299 The battery supports 1,000 W input and 800 W output, is compatible with most balcony PV systems, and can be optionally app-controlled via a dedicated app.

Morocco finally unlocks solar self‑consumption Morocco has published the implementing decree for Law 82‑21, enabling self-producers to consume their own solar power and sell up to 20% of surplus energy back to the grid. The measure, effective 9 June 2026, sets clear tariffs and grid limits.

Morocco begins construction on 305 MW Noor Atlas solar program Morocco’s state energy agency and national utility have signed power purchase agreements (PPAs) and begun construction on six Noor Atlas solar plants totaling 305 MW. The project – financed by KfW, the European Investment Bank and Bank of Africa – aims to expand renewables, support local industry and create regional jobs.

Key takeaways from Solaire Expo Maroc A pavilion dedicated to electric vehicles, a dominant Chinese presence and limited European representation shaped the solar trade show held Feb. 10 to 12 in Casablanca, Morocco. Local distributors warned of rising prices for Chinese solar equipment, while a booming commercial and industrial (C&I) segment, a nascent residential market, emerging storage demand and largely untapped solar potential underscored the sector’s direction.
